Dealers who are members of the Society of the Irish Motor Industry (SIMI) follow a code of ethics, which includes carrying out checks on the cars they sell.

A guarantee, even a brief one, can bring comfort. Be especially careful with your checks because you will have fewer legal protections for private sales. Ask about any warranties offered by the Cavan dealer you are purchasing from. This can be a sign of professionalism and reliability. Verify that the handbook is present because it includes important details about the features and maintenance schedule of the vehicle.

Just as crucial as the vehicle itself is the paperwork. Inquire about the service history and check for entries related to routine maintenance. The vehicle has been well-maintained, as evidenced by a stamped service book or a folder of receipts.
